AI模型调用显卡深度解析,主要探讨技术原理与实践方法。本文从硬件与软件层面,详述显卡在AI模型调用中的关键作用,包括GPU架构、CUDA编程、深度学习框架等。结合实际案例,解析了如何优化AI模型调用,提高计算效率。
随着人工智能技术的迅猛进步,AI模型在各个领域的应用日益广泛,在模型训练与推理过程中,显卡(GPU)凭借其卓越的并行计算能力,成为了AI模型的首选计算,本文将深入剖析AI模型如何高效调用显卡,从技术核心到实际操作,旨在为读者提供全面的理解和指导。

1. 显卡与CPU的对比
显卡(GPU)与CPU(中央处理器)都是计算机统的核心组件,但它们在架构与功能上存在显著的不同,CPU擅长处理单一任务,而GPU则擅长并行处理,这使得GPU在执行大规模并行计算任务时展现出更高的效率。
2. CUDA与OpenCL
CUDA和OpenCL是两种主流的GPU编程接口,它们使得开发者能够充分利用GPU的并行计算能力,CUDA主要针对NVIDIA显卡,而OpenCL则支持多种硬件。
3. 量计算
AI模型中的神经主要基于量计算,量是数学中的一个概念,代表多维数组,在GPU上,量计算能够充分利用其并行特性,实现高效的计算过程。
4. GPU内存架构
GPU内存架构包括全局内存、常量内存、纹理内存和共享内存,全局内存用于存储大规模数据,常量内存用于存储少量常量数据,纹理内存用于存储图像数据,共享内存用于存储共享数据。
1. 选择合适的GPU
在选择GPU时,需考虑以下因素:
2. 安装驱动程序和开发工具
在安装GPU驱动程序和开发工具之前,请确保统已安装CUDA或OpenCL运行时库。
3. 编写GPU加速代码
以下是一个使用CUDA的简单示例代码:
#include <stdio.h>
#include <cuda_runtime.h>
__global__ void add(int *a, int *b, int *c) {
int idx = threadIdx.x + blockIdx.x * blockDim.x;
c[idx] = a[idx] + b[idx];
int main() {
const int N = 1024;
int *a, *b, *c;
int size = N * sizeof(int);
// 分配GPU内存
cudaMalloc(&a, size);
cudaMalloc(&b, size);
cudaMalloc(&c, size);
// 将数据从主机传输到GPU
int host_a[N], host_b[N];
for (int i = 0; i < N; i++) {
host_a[i] = i;
host_b[i] = i * 2;
}
cudaMemcpy(a, host_a, size, cudaMemcpyHostToDevice);
cudaMemcpy(b, host_b, size, cudaMemcpyHostToDevice);
// 配置GPU线程和块
int threadsPerBlock = 256;
int blocksPerGrid = (N + threadsPerBlock - 1) / threadsPerBlock;
add<<<blocksPerGrid, threadsPerBlock>>>(a, b, c);
// 将结果从GPU传输回主机
int result[N];
cudaMemcpy(result, c, size, cudaMemcpyDeviceToHost);
// 释放GPU内存
cudaFree(a);
cudaFree(b);
cudaFree(c);
// 打印结果
for (int i = 0; i < N; i++) {
printf("%d ", result[i]);
}
printf("
");
return 0;
}
4. 使用深度学习框架
深度学习框架如TensorFlow、PyTorch等提供了GPU加速功能,以下是一个使用PyTorch的简单示例:
import torch
# 创建两个随机量
a = torch.randn(1024)
b = torch.randn(1024)
# 使用GPU加速
a = a.cuda()
b = b.cuda()
# 计算并打印结果
c = a + b
print(c)
本文从技术核心和实践步骤两方面详细阐述了AI模型调用显卡的过程,深入了解这一关键环节有助于开发者充分利用GPU的并行计算能力,提升AI模型的训练和推理效率,随着GPU技术的持续发展,AI模型调用显卡必将成为人工智能领域的重要研究方向。
相关阅读:
1、AI模型,揭秘其分类与应用
2、iPhone 7充电与耳机兼容性解析及使用小贴士
3、未来科技奇观,AI模型生崽之谜揭秘
4、AI模型碎片获取揭秘,智能时代新武器大揭秘
5、AI模型训练数据提取,核心技术解析与应用探讨
相关文章:
AI唱将养成记,揭秘个性化虚拟歌手训练模型软件,论文写作ai助手 软件
文心一言,人工智能写作领域的性突破与当前水平解析,ai男团账号
小度研发之路,摒弃文心一言,自主研发的智慧选择,ai公司标语
跨越模态界限,AI模型的多模态进化之旅,晚风告白AI
豆包AI写作助手,智能助力还是未来替代?,ai泰坦音响
AI大模型,解锁未来无限潜能的钥匙,ai金字塔用什么ai软件
拓尔思AI预训练大模型,领航智能未来,推动行业革新,www.400ai.com 升级
从零起步,AI客服开源模型构建手册,淮南ai制造大会
文心一言智能体电脑,引领创意工作未来潮流,ai黑客照片
文心一言,穿越时空的恋爱奇缘,测ai17
AI小模型在多元场景下的创新应用探索,ai文章图
AI引领漫画创作革新,关键词、模型深度解析与应用展望,bin ai贝贝
AI大数据模型重塑量化交易未来,揭秘其魅力与,海信AI换台
人工智能助手文心一言,开启下一代交互体验革新之旅,特种纸的制作ai
AI训练大模型失败案例分析及优化策略研究,ai 打散
AI与三维建模的跨界融合,AI赋能3D模型新,落月ai
轻松上手AI模型导入,步骤详解与技巧分享,ai与背叛催眠
AI赋能动画制作,开启动画行业新的技术革新,用ai写作 好不好
文心一言,解锁阅读新体验的人工智能助手,AI*案例分析
AI赋能,明星AI训练模型揭秘与未来趋势洞察,高达ai绘图
智能时代新伙伴,AI模型软件助你便捷生活,ai63358
文心一言解密,接收时长之谜,开启沟通新篇章,初爱ai
AI豆包软件革新声音克隆,塑造未来语音交互新篇章,ai怎么画规则
文心绘猫,一画传家国情怀,ai和ps哪个内存更大
AI驱动制造革新,美好模型从梦想变为现实,华为ai音箱生态链
文心一言全新升级,产品矩阵全面揭秘,ai建筑原理
文心一言小程序全新发布,开启便捷生活新篇章,ai写作头条有收益吗知乎
AI绘画,揭秘潮流软件及其广泛应用,ai中秋拍照
国内开源AI模型库,助力人工智能创新发展的关键枢纽,AI南洋
AI赋能沙雕艺术,趣味与艺术融合的全新,华为电脑有ai字幕翻译
文心一言,AI助力轻松打造个人简历,开启高效求职新篇章,ai95919
AI量化交易模型软件精选指南,助投资者金融市场扬帆远航,王者ai挑战20关
AI写作新,文心一言4.0深度解析与功能升级,知网推出AI写作选题
AI与大数据驱动的股票市场交易模型,机遇与并存的未来,ai白描设计
轻松掌握AI模型下载全攻略,电脑使用ai写作功能
文心一言测评,人工智能写作助手表现力与创造力深度解析,ai化验技术
ERNIE-4.0 8K,文心一言开启自然语言处理新时代,ai渐变对齐
解码AI大脑,人工智能模型通俗解析,ai海边海报
AI摄影,揭秘最逼真的照片级AI模型软件,高级ai程序
C4D原模型在AI导入后神秘消失,揭秘原因与修复之道,ai94694426
文心一言撤稿风波,揭秘真相与深远影响,ai像素风
AI建模引领智能时代革新之旅,ai_0888
智能语音新篇章,语音训练AI模型入门指南,小米的ai视频播放器
文心一语,揭秘人工智能的文学创造力,ai制币
文心一言App横空出世,创新营销策略引领市场新潮,ai文字弧形设计
AI赋能立体建模,高精度立体模型构建全方位攻略,ai绘图视频写作app好用吗
文一言心与豆包,经典零食的优劣对决,昆明ai全网通价格
我国人工智能领域的璀璨明珠,360大模型AI深度揭秘,精准Ai智能
高效构建AI模型组合,多组模型训练选择策略,ai超市服务
云端AI模型交互揭秘,下载模型,还是运算?,外贸行业ai